3 Setup vanuit Debian/Ubuntu-pakketten
Overzicht
Als geïnstalleerd van Debian/Ubuntu-pakketten, zal de volgende informatie u helpen bij Zabbix instellen Java-gateway.
Java-gateway configureren en uitvoeren
Java-gatewayconfiguratie kan worden getuned in het bestand:
/etc/zabbix/zabbix_java_gateway.conf
Zie Zabbix Java-gatewayconfiguratie voor meer informatie parameters.
Zabbix Java-gateway starten:
# service zabbix-java-gateway restart
Zabbix Java-gateway automatisch starten bij het opstarten:
# systemctl enable zabbix-java-gateway
Server configureren voor gebruik met Java-gateway
Met Java-gateway in gebruik, moet u de Zabbix-server vertellen waar de Zabbix Java-gateway te vinden is. Dit wordt gedaan door JavaGateway op te geven en JavaGatewayPort-parameters in de serverconfiguratie bestand. Als de host waarop JMX applicatie wordt uitgevoerd wordt gecontroleerd door Zabbix proxy, dan specificeert u de verbindingsparameters in de proxyconfiguratie file in plaats daarvan.
JavaGateway=192.168.3.14
JavaGatewayPort=10052
Standaard start de server geen processen gerelateerd aan JMX toezicht houden. Als u het echter wilt gebruiken, moet u de aantal pre-forked instances van Java pollers. Je doet dit in dezelfde manier waarop u reguliere pollers en trappers specificeert.
StartJavaPollers=5
Vergeet niet om de server of proxy opnieuw te starten als je klaar bent met ze configureren.
Java-gateway debuggen
Zabbix Java gateway-logbestand is:
/var/log/zabbix/zabbix_java_gateway.log
Als u de logboek registratie wilt vergroten, bewerkt u het bestand:
/etc/zabbix/zabbix_java_gateway_logback.xml
en verander level="info" in "debug" of zelfs "trace" (voor diepgaand
probleem oplossen):
<configuratie scan="true" scanPeriod="15 seconden">
[...]
<root level="info">
<appender-ref ref="BESTAND" />
</root>
</configuratie>
JMX-bewaking
Zie JMX-monitoring pagina voor meer details.